Puppy Classes
The purpose of the five week course is to help you understand your puppy and learn why he behaves as he does. Also, to socialize your puppy with other dogs and people. Learn about house training, playing, hygiene, how to stop biting and jumping up, and how to get your puppy to come when called. Plus lots, lots more. Your puppy is eligible to join the course from the time vaccinations are completed up to 20 weeks of age. The venue is secure thus allowing puppies to run free and in safety.

Obedience Classes
Moving on from puppyhood, it's never too late to teach your dog better manners. Dogs will learn by love, play and praise. Our five week courses are designed to help individual needs and standards. Positive reinforcement methods are used at all times - punishment of any kind and check chains are never used.
